Alceu Maia

Noticed by Beth Carvalho, who asked him to become listed on her strap, Alceu Maia (aka Alceu Cavaquinho and Alceu perform Cavaco) was among the members from the A Fina Flor perform Samba, that was Carvalho’s assisting group and in addition developed a single career. A Clear Prize champion (as greatest arranger), Maia also was granted having a Brahma Extra trophy and a Cinco Estrelas trophy as an instrumentalist. His resumé contains functions for Chet Baker and Dionne Warwick. Since 1975 a occupied session guy, Maia continues to be playing for top level works like Cartola, Chico Buarque, João Bosco, Elizeth Cardoso, Paulinho da Viola, Clara Nunes, Nélson Gonçalves, Bezerra da Silva, Toquinho, and Elba Ramalho. He also offers toured internationally (through European countries, the U.S., Africa, and Latin America) with Paulo Moura (in the Berlin Event), Ivan Lins, Roberto Menescal, Leila Pinheiro, and Joyce. As the soloist of his group Alceu Maia & O Choro Unétrico, he performed in the Montreux Event (Switzerland). He was the maker of the strike “Voa, Canarinho, Voa” (the music found in the Brazilian team marketing campaign in the Globe Cup, sung from the participant Júnior). Maia also created the high-selling carnival information of the champ samba schools. Like a composer, he has already established over 100 tracks documented by Leci Brandão (“Talento de Verdade,” created with Brandão, and “Fogo no Ar,” with Jorge Aragão), Emílio Santiago, Alcione, Demônios da Garoa, Jair Rodrigues, Mestre Marçal, and Agepê, amongst others. Maia also participated both in the display and the recording Getz Bossa Nova, released in Japan, with Gilberto Gil, Leila Pinheiro, and Marcos Valle. Like a soloist, he documented, among additional albums, the Compact disc Brasil Chorinho with classics of choro.
